Extremely Unprofessional, Negligent, and Damaging to Landlords – Avoid This Agency

My experience with Leaders Acorn Group has been one of the most distressing, frustrating, and financially damaging situations I’ve ever faced as a landlord. I trusted this agency with the management of my property — and I deeply regret it. Here are the facts: I paid for a professional check-in report, which turned out to be incomplete. Critical areas of the property — including the section where a valuable water softener was installed — were entirely omitted. Later, when the item was missing from the property, the omission resulted in a complete lack of evidence to prove it had been stolen, and my claim was dismissed.( even in the plumber report, he clearly stated the water softner was there!) Communication was appalling throughout the tenancy. I had to chase them repeatedly with no resolution. My inquiries were routinely ignored, leaving me to deal with issues alone. When the tenancy ended, they attempted to pressure me into a new tenancy with a replacement tenant, without providing any due diligence or proper references. When I requested background information, I was accused of discrimination, despite the fact that I had not been given — or commented on — any details about the prospective tenant whatsoever. I only asked for the references !!!!! They also tried to charge me for a photography session that never took place( the second time), and later attempted to unlawfully charge me fees for a breach of contract after I had made it clear I was not renewing my business with them. Only after I made it clear I would pursue legal action and I'm not in contract with them anymore, did they quietly withdraw the claim. As if that wasn’t enough, when the tenancy ended and I submitted my claim for damages — with supporting evidence, invoices, contractor reports, and photographic proof — the deposit process was deliberately delayed. Eventually, in what felt like a petty and vengeful act, their adjudicator dismissed the majority of the claim, awarding me a pitiful £654 out of a £5,000+ claim, despite extensive damage to the property, illegal over-occupancy (more than 10 people living there under a contract for 2), and written evidence from a contractor stating the damage was due to heavy misuse. This agency has shown negligence, dishonesty, misconduct and a complete disregard for landlords' rights. Their actions — and inaction — directly cost me thousands of pounds. If you are a landlord, I strongly advise you: do not trust this company with your property.
